University of Mary

University of Mary is located in Bismarck, North Dakota.

It is a private University.

University of Mary offers following types of degrees and certificate programs:

  • Bachelor's degree
  • Master's degree
  • Post-master's certificate
  • Doctor's degree for professional practice

Acceptance rate at University of Mary for undergraduate program was 73.55%.

Last year, 1376 students applied for undergraduate program and 1012 got accepted.

Acceptance rate of 73.55% makes it relatively easy to get admission.

1256 enrolled in graduate programs, which includes on campus and online Master's programs.

538 are reported as enrolled exclusively in distance education and 338 are enrolled in at least one distance education course, but not all distance education.

University of Mary had 2957 students enrolled in undergraduate programs.

University of Mary most popular Master's Degree programs with respect to student count are

  • Business Administration and Management -MBA : 168
  • Occupational Therapy/Therapist : 51
  • Physical Therapy and Therapist : 44
  • Nursing Administration : 28
  • Nursing Practice : 24

University of Mary most popular under graduate programs with respect to student count are

  • Registered Nurse : 94
  • Business Administration and Management -MBA : 54
  • Psychology : 35
  • Elementary Education and Teaching : 23
  • General Studies : 23
